Symptom: users logged out every ~15 min. Cause: refresh endpoint rejects tokens minted before the Harlequin cutover.

Steps:
1. Confirm error rate on the corvane-auth dashboard exceeds 2%.
2. Toggle `legacy_refresh_grace` to true in Fleetline config.
3. Restart the token service pods in rolling batches of three.
4. Watch refresh success rate for 10 minutes; abort if below 95%.
5. Notify the Ostermark support queue.

Do not clear the session store. Record the build marker shown below in the release log.

build token for kagaf-hahof: htk14_9d3d4d26d7d8de

Quarterly Planning Note — Loyalty Overhaul, Thistledown Grocers

Branch managers: the Harvest Points programme will be replaced by the new Hearthside scheme in Q2. Points balances convert at a fixed rate; tills will be updated overnight before launch week. Expect staff training packs two weeks prior. Redemption margins tighten slightly, offset by higher repeat-visit targets. Do not announce dates to customers until head office confirms. Pilot branches in Marwick and Ellsfield go first. The strategic reasoning behind the timing appears below.

board note of bawep-tajef: Queniusek Systems plans to raise the Quenvan list price by 53.1 percent in March. The pricing group signed off on a budget of $176.4 million for Project Drueth. The renewal with Casionix Partners closes at $142.5 million a year, 8.3 percent below the last contract. Project Fraax slips by six weeks because of the tooling delay.

The committee reviewed the proposed entry into the Vastermere coastal corridor. Distribution costs were examined in detail; L. Brask noted that the Kelder Bay warehouse lease remains under negotiation and cautioned against premature staffing commitments. Market sizing figures were accepted with reservations pending a second survey. The phased rollout timeline was approved in principle. The following note summarizes the underlying strategic rationale.

confidential, yahip-hagug: Gorixax Logistics plans to lower the Ulaael list price by 26.6 percent in October. The pricing group signed off on a budget of $199.9 million for Project Holix. The renewal with Kasdorox Systems closes at $137.5 million a year, 8.2 percent above the last contract. Project Lamion slips by a full year because of the audit delay.